Dog case headed to trial

ROARING SPRING – Tammy Sneath Grimes will face a jury trial on charges that she stole a dog Sept. 11 from a Freedom Township property.

Grimes appeared in front of Magisterial District Judge Craig Ormsby today. Two of the charges, criminal mischief and criminal trespass, were withdrawn by prosecutors at the start of the hearing.

Ormsby declined attempts by Grimes and her attorney to provide a justification for her actions, saying that is a matter to be heard by the Blair County Court of Common Pleas.

About 50 people who support Grimes attended the hearing.
